1972 GMC K1500 Sierra Grande by Vockal Motors – Built to Outrun Time
Hand-built in the USA by Vockal Motors in 2025, this 1972 GMC K1500 Sierra Grande is the past and future welded into one. Classic square-body looks. Modern firepower. Every inch purpose-built on a custom Frame-Werx 4WD chassis with high-end components and zero shortcuts.
Under the Hood
6.2L LS3 V8 (Stage II, 525HP)
6L80E auto (rated for 600HP)
Holley Performance gear & MagnaFlow dual stainless exhaust
Doug Thorley headers, GM manual transfer case, and cold air intake
Chassis & Handling
GMT IFS 4WD chassis with 4-link rear and sway bars
Wilwood 14" 6-piston brakes w/ hydroboost and drilled/slotted rotors
Fox shocks, 4" BDS lift, power steering rack, and anti-roll bar
18” Mayhem Voyagers wrapped in 35” AMP Terrain Attacks
Interior & Electronics
Dakota Digital RTX gauges + Mil-spec wiring
Resto-mod A/C, power windows/locks, tilt “I Did It” column
9” Pioneer touchscreen w/ Bluetooth, Nav, Apple Play, 8-speaker audio
Alcantara and Relocate plaid interior: seats, dash, headliner
Reclining buckets, wireless charging, locking center console
Extras & Finish
AMP power steps, wood bed inlay, custom tail-light fuel fill
Tow package, backup cam, cruise control, American Autowire harness
Year-specific Ron Davis radiator + full cooling package
